This month’s theme was Hidden Worlds!

Up first, we have a sticker and a candle!

The sticker was from Alice in Wonderland featuring Alice and the White Rabbit.

The small candle from Books on Candles was inspired by The Chronicles of Narnia, and it was called “Through the Wardrobe”.

Up next, there was a pencil pouch with a quote from Daughter of Smoke and Bone by Laini Taylor featuring art from Risa Rodil.

There was also a button key necklace inspired by Coraline by Neil Gaiman.

Lastly before the book, Owlcrate outdid themselves! Every box came with a giant wall tapestry with art from eviebookish (which you can purchase here!), and it required the help of my bookshelves to show off!

And the moment we’ve all been waiting for: this month’s book pick was….

The Hazel Wood by Melissa Albert! As you all know, I thoroughly enjoyed this one when I read it in January, so I’m stoked to have this exclusive edition! It’s Hinterland green, which is very on-theme with the story. It came with stickers, a note from the author, and every copy was signed as well!
